We had 2 late 80's or early 90's GN125s as part of our local MTP fleet ... in fact I trained on one of them when I took the Learn to Ride Program back in '03 ... good 'lil Bikes ... we only retired our 2 GN Trainers last year (replaced with a couple of new GZ250s).
